Noble Prize for Individuals Ignores Collaborations

[T]here is a tradition that the science prizes are given to individuals, not to collaborations — and to no more than three individuals in any one year.

That tradition needs to end. Science has always been an intensely collaborative pursuit, and prizes to individuals are rarely able to capture the full nuance of the historical reality. In the modern era, when communication between scientists anywhere on earth is instantaneous and effortless, collaborations are growing larger and more central to the scientific enterprise.
